The cheapest way to get from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a to Pisa is to train which costs €9 - €16 and takes 2h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a to Pisa is to drive which takes 1h 27m and costs €13 - €19.
No, there is no direct bus from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a to Pisa. However, there are services departing from Colle V.Elsa and arriving at Pisa Airport via Firenze Santa Maria Novella.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h.
The distance between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a and Pisa is 93 km. The road distance is 86 km.
The best way to get from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a to Pisa without a car is to train which takes 2h 32m and costs €9 - €16.
It takes approximately 2h 32m to get from Relais Della Rovere, Colle Val D'Elsa to Pisa, including transfers.
